Understanding the IELTS Writing Test
The IELTS composing test is divided into 2 tasks:
Task 1: Candidates must summarize or explain visual info (such as charts, charts, and diagrams) in about 150 words.Job 2: Candidates are required to react to an argument or a problem provided in a timely, crafting an official essay of at least 250 words.IELTS Writing Structure

1. Comprehend the Assessment Criteria
Familiarize yourself with the IELTS composing assessment criteria. Understanding how your writing will be assessed can help you focus on the best locations during practice. Each task has particular elements that inspectors try to find, consisting of:
Task Achievement: Answering the concern fully and appropriately.Coherence and Cohesion: Logical flow and clear connections in between ideas.Lexical Resource: Use of a series of vocabulary and appropriate language.Grammatical Range and Accuracy: Correct use of grammar and a range of syntax.2. How can I enhance my IELTS writing rating?
To improve your rating, practice routinely, focus on the evaluation criteria, and look for feedback. Take part in timed composing workouts and construct your vocabulary.
2. What is the very best method to prepare for Task 2?
For Task 2, practice conceptualizing ideas, structuring your arguments, and composing clear essays. Joining a research study group can also assist in generating diverse perspectives.
3. Exist any specific subjects that appear often in Task 2?
Common topics in Task 2 consist of education, innovation, environment, and health. Familiarize yourself with these themes and practice writing essays around them.
4. How essential is grammar in IELTS writing?
Grammar is one of the 4 assessment criteria in IELTS writing. Frequent grammatical errors can decrease your rating, so it's necessary to practice right sentence structures.
5. Can I utilize casual language in IELTS essays?
IELTS essays require official language. Prevent slang, contractions, and excessively casual expressions to keep a suitable tone.
